Sandro Tonali’s departure was the rotating door moment for the arrival of Tijjani Reijnders, and now, it could be time for the latter to make his own AC Milan departure.
When Milan have been so poor, it would be easy to shine. However, stating Reijnders’ performances are a shining light in a bad team would be a disservice. Put simply, the midfielder would be a star in any team, and he has the identikit to be a star for years to come.
So, it seems likely that there will be a number of teams asking about the former AZ Alkmaar player in the summer. As Tuttosport’s morning edition stated, the performances have not gone unnoticed by Europe’s elite, as relayed by Milan News, and as a result, there will be plenty of knocks on the door.
Real Madrid and Manchester City have already begun to take notice of his situation, and offers are likely to arrive this summer. In fact, the situation can be compared to that of Sandro Tonali’s departure, as unfortunate as that is for the Rossoneri.
Despite this, the Diavolo ‘remain confident’ of their ability to retain the player, especially with him signing a new contract this year.
